Regulatory Quality - Governance score in Malta
Malta: Regulatory Quality - Governance score was 62.62 0-100 in 2024. ▼ Falling
Regulatory Quality - Governance score in Malta, 1996–2024
Source: The Worldwide Governance Indicators: Revised Methodology for Measuring Governance Using Perception Data., World Bank Group (WBG). Measured in 0-100.
Analysis
Malta recorded 62.62 0-100 for regulatory quality - governance score in 2024.
The figure is down 0.9% on the previous year and down 8.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, regulatory quality - governance score in Malta peaked at 76.28 0-100 in 2008 and was at its lowest, 62.05 0-100, in 1996.
Malta ranks 57th of 204 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 26 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 65.4 0-100 | 62.05 0-100 | 68.74 0-100 | 2 |
| 2000s | 73.84 0-100 | 69.73 0-100 | 76.28 0-100 | 9 |
| 2010s | 72.61 0-100 | 67.91 0-100 | 75.96 0-100 | 10 |
| 2020s | 65.57 0-100 | 62.62 0-100 | 72.06 0-100 | 5 |

About this data
Regulatory Quality (RQ) captures perceptions of the government’s ability to design and implement policies and regulations that promote private sector development. Governance score is a linear transformation of the governance estimate using hypothetical worst-case and base-case countries. It is an absolute score ranging from 0-100. Larger values correspond to better governance. The (country-series-time) metadata include the (a) number of sources, and (b) confidence intervals (lower and upper bound). The number of sources indicates the number of underlying data sources on which the governance score (respectively the underlying governance estimate) is based. The confidence intervals include the lower and upper bound of the 90% confidence interval for the governance score. Confidence intervals are a statistical range of values that likely contain the true value (of what is being estimated).
